Jean-Baptiste Pelletier 1734–1796 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 11 December 1734

Birth Location: L'Assomption, Lanaudiere Region, Quebec, Canada

Death Date: 27 November 1796

Death Location: L'Assomption, Lanaudiere Region, Quebec, Canada

Father: Jean-Baptiste Pelletier

Mother: Marie Durand

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

In 1734, Jean-Baptiste Pelletier entered the world in L'Assomption, Lanaudiere Region, Quebec, Canada, born to Jean Baptiste Pelletier And Marie Charlotte Chevigny Durand. Jean-Baptiste Pelletier passed away in 1796 in L'Assomption, Lanaudiere Region, Quebec, Canada.
